13.11 Hardware and Software Constraints
86
AT91SAM9G20
Note:
The SPI and NAND Flash drivers use several PIOs in alternate functions to communicate with
devices. Care must be taken when these PIOs are used by the application. The devices con-
nected could be unintentionally driven at boot time, and electrical conflicts between SPI output
pins and the connected devices may appear.
To assure correct functionality, it is recommended to plug in critical devices to other pins.
Table 13-8
are driven during the boot sequence for a period of less than 1 second if no correct boot program
is found.
Before performing the jump to the application in internal SRAM, all the PIOs and peripherals
used in the boot program are set to their reset state.
